      Frequently Asked Questions

      Is Newtown & St Leonards safer than Okehampton Rural East?

      Newtown & St Leonards has a safety score of 8/100 (High Crime) and recorded 8,836 crimes in the last 12 months. Okehampton Rural East has a safety score of 67/100 (Safe) with 230 crimes. Okehampton Rural East scores higher on the CrimeRadar safety index.

      What is the crime trend in Newtown & St Leonards vs Okehampton Rural East?

      Newtown & St Leonards shows a year-on-year crime trend of -2.5% — meaning total crimes fell compared to the same period the prior year. Okehampton Rural East shows -19.9% (falling). A downward trend is a positive sign for an area.

      How does anti-social behaviour compare between Newtown & St Leonards and Okehampton Rural East?

      Newtown & St Leonards recorded 1,467 anti-social behaviour incidents in the last 12 months, while Okehampton Rural East recorded 19. Anti-social behaviour includes rowdiness, nuisance and disorder that disrupts daily life but may not result in a criminal charge.

      How do violent crime levels compare in Newtown & St Leonards vs Okehampton Rural East?

      Violent crime in Newtown & St Leonards totalled 3,182 incidents over the last 12 months, compared to 122 in Okehampton Rural East. Violent crime includes assault with and without injury, harassment, and public order offences.

      What is the resolution rate for crimes in Newtown & St Leonards and Okehampton Rural East?

      The resolution rate is the percentage of recorded crimes that resulted in a formal outcome — such as a charge, caution, penalty notice, or community resolution. Newtown & St Leonards has a resolution rate of 20.8% and Okehampton Rural East has 33.3%. A higher rate indicates police are more frequently resolving reported crimes in that area.

      What data is used to compare Newtown & St Leonards and Okehampton Rural East?

      CrimeRadar uses 36 months of official recorded crime data from the UK Police API, updated each month. The safety score combines crime volume relative to the force average, year-on-year trend direction, and resolution rate. All figures are based on crimes recorded within each police-defined neighbourhood boundary.
